Web•One can envisage two extreme forms of cyclobutane: A planar form and a bent form (referred to as the puckered form). •The planar cyclobutane has all its 8 C-Hs in an eclipsed arrangement with bond angles of 90o, while the puckered conformation has a bond angle of 88o. •Although the puckered conformation increases the angle WebThe DNA photodimers showed interconversion of the puckered-twist of the cyclobutane ring between CB- and CB+ and interconversion of the glycosidic angle between syn and anti in …

WebA four-membered ring can be either planar or puckered. Unsubstituted cyclobutane and azetidine prefer a wing-shaped conformation with small inversion barriers of 1.45 and 1.26 kcal mol − 1, respectively, while oxetane is essentially planar. 52 When two four-membered rings are fused together to form a spiro[3.3] system, the two four-membered ...
